On the 2017 the text messages are no longer introduced by the computer voice (this is what happens on a Windows phone) which is nice, but the email icon comes up on the screen and the music gets cut off and I have to push the phone "hang up" button to get the music back on.

The only way to avoid the verbal announcement is to turn the blue tooth off on the phone.

I have an LG G4 and after the latest update it doesn't load texts anymore. I can make calls through the bluetooth, but when I go to texts it doesn't show anything. Any suggestions? I only use it when the car is stopped at a light.

Also, the bluetooth on the car is now a bit flaky. Sometimes I get it and it works, other times it is connected for data only and won't allow music to come through the PCM so I have to disable blootooth on my phone, renable it, then reconnect to the PCM and allow the connection. A real pain!
